Chapter 37 - Carry that weight

Rael screamed from inside Togis' steel shell.

His body could not regenerate.

His bloodline had slipped into slumber after defeating Sister Sophia.

A mental block now muted most of his powers.

He lay on the floor, clutching his shirt while sweat poured and blood leaked in alarming streams.

As Togis lumbered from the junkyard, the orphans watched in fright.

Rael's cries set fragile children sobbing, smothering any urge to cheer his victory.

Clutching her plush toy, Anne forced herself to speak.

"Will Rael come back?"

Tears streaked her cheeks as she met the old tortoise's eyes.

"My Lord will return. Go home and wait for him. Leave the rest to us adults," Togis said.

He quickened his pace.

Authorities would soon search the site.

Even the city outskirts felt unsafe while Rael howled.

The children watched until the guardian disappeared on the horizon.

Dominica drew Rael's mind into his private virtual room.

Shiran waited there, tail trembling.
